Comprehending the Role of a Psychiatrist
Before diving into finding a private psychiatrist, it's necessary to comprehend the function they play in psychological healthcare:
Specialized Education: Psychiatrists are medical physicians who concentrate on psychological health, having undergone extensive training that includes both medical and psychiatric education.
Diagnosis and Treatment: They are equipped to identify psychological health conditions, recommend medication, and offer numerous restorative interventions.
Holistic Approach: Beyond medication, they often operate in tandem with psychologists, social employees, and other psychological health experts to supply extensive care.
